Technical Theater and Theater Teaching Artist In search of a theater set designer, artist and teacher to lead students in creating a set for a production of Matilda JR. Teaching Artist will also lead Student Crew in being stagehands and cueing lights and sound. Does not have to be proficient in sound or lighting design, will only assist in those capacities unless otherwise desired.

With the director and music director, you will:

Collaborate on the set design

Collaborate on sourcing materials

Provide rough drawings that will serve as guides to discuss and ensure clarity of communication

Collaborate with Music Director on sound design

Collaborate with lighting designer on light cues

Collaborate with costume designer to support crew in helping with costume measurements and distribution

Attend occasional production meetings with production staff, Create timelines and collaborate on lesson plans for crew students

Independently you will:

Lead the student stage crew to create the sets

Communicate with crew students

Paint sets and backdrops

Organize, clean and maintain tools, supplies and work space

Create any necessary props (some are already in storage)

Strike the set

Qualifications:

Experience creating theatrical sets

Experience teaching visual art or stagecraft

Experience backstage in a theatrical setting

Qualities looked for:

Works well in a collaborative setting and independently

Resourceful and reliable

Ability to successfully plan and lead a team
